Compression socks are specially designed garments that apply gentle pressure to the legs and ankles, promoting better blood circulation. They work by helping blood flow back to one's heart, reducing the pooling of blood in the low extremities. This improved circulation can prevent and alleviate common issues such as for instance swelling, varicose veins, and even deep vein thrombosis (DVT). Those who stand or sit for extended hours, like office workers, nurses, or travelers, often experience significant relief from wearing compression socks. By encouraging blood flow, these socks may also reduce the impression of heaviness and fatigue in the legs, making them a well known choice for individuals with a dynamic lifestyle or those recovering from surgery.

Hydrocolloid dressings are an innovative wound care solution widely utilized in clinical and home care settings for managing various types of wounds. These dressings are produced from a variety of gel-forming agents, such as for instance carboxymethylcellulose, pectin, and gelatin, embedded inside a flexible and adhesive outer layer. Their particular composition allows them to create a moist environment conducive to wound healing, which facilitates faster tissue regeneration and minimizes scarring. By maintaining a maximum balance of moisture and protecting the wound from external contaminants, hydrocolloid dressings have become a vital component of modern wound care practices.

The mechanism of hydrocolloid dressings is predicated on their power to communicate with wound exudate. Upon experience of moisture, the dressing's gel-forming agents Medical Suppliers Durban the exudate and form a gel-like substance. This gel not just seals the wound but also prevents it from becoming dry, which is critical for the healing process. The moist environment encourages the migration of epithelial cells, supports the break down of necrotic tissue, and reduces pain by covering nerve endings. Additionally, hydrocolloid dressings are semi-permeable, allowing oxygen exchange while blocking bacteria and other harmful microorganisms, thus minimizing the chance of infection.

Hydrocolloid dressings offer numerous benefits in comparison to traditional wound dressings. Their ability to keep a moist healing environment accelerates the healing process and reduces the likelihood of scarring. Moreover, their self-adhesive properties make them easy to use and remove without causing trauma to the wound site. The flexibleness of the dressings ensures they conform to various body contours, making them suited to challenging areas like elbows and knees. Additionally they give a barrier against contaminants, reducing the chance of wound infections. The comfort and discreet appearance of hydrocolloid dressings cause them to become ideal for long-term use, enhancing patient compliance and overall satisfaction.

Hydrocolloid dressings are versatile and can be used for a wide selection of wounds. They're particularly effective in managing low-to-moderate exuding wounds, such as for instance pressure ulcers, minor burns, surgical incisions, and abrasions. These dressings are also gaining popularity in the treatment of acne because of the power to absorb pus and reduce inflammation while protecting the skin. In chronic wound care, hydrocolloid dressings play a critical role in managing diabetic foot ulcers and venous leg ulcers, as they supply the required protection and promote granulation tissue formation.

Applying hydrocolloid dressings correctly is critical for achieving optimal results. The wound area must be cleaned thoroughly and dried before application to make certain good adhesion. The dressing must be slightly larger compared to the wound to permit for a protected seal. Once applied, it can stay in area for several days, with respect to the amount of exudate and the particular product instructions. Removal of the dressing should be performed carefully to prevent trauma to the wound bed. Any residue from the gel should be gently cleaned before reapplying a brand new dressing.

Biltong, a normal South African delicacy, has a rich history that dates back to the early settlers of the region. The word “biltong” is derived from the Dutch words “bil” (meaning rump) and “tong” (meaning strip or tongue). It originated as a functional way to preserve meat during long treks and harsh weather conditions. The indigenous Khoisan people had their very own methods of drying and preserving meat, of later adapted by Dutch settlers. Combining salt, vinegar, and spices, they developed a technique that not merely extended the shelf life of meat but also enhanced its flavor. This preserved meat became a choice for travelers, hunters, and farmers, laying the foundation for the modern biltong we enjoy today.

Unlike other preserved meats, such as for example jerky, biltong sticks out because preparation method and ingredients. The meat is first marinated in vinegar, which South African biltong not merely enhances the flavor but also serves as a natural preservative. It is then seasoned with a blend of spices, including coriander, black pepper, and salt, and hung to air-dry for all days. This natural drying process, rather than using heat, gives biltong its distinct texture and rich taste. Additionally, biltong could be produced from various forms of meat, including beef, game meats like kudu or ostrich, and even chicken, rendering it a versatile snack.

Biltong is not just a flavorful treat but also a highly nutritious snack. It is packed with protein, rendering it an excellent choice for athletes, bodybuilders, and anyone looking for a healthy, high-protein option. Unlike many other processed snacks, biltong is free of artificial additives and preservatives. It's low in carbohydrates, which makes it ideal for those following low-carb or ketogenic diets. Additionally, biltong contains essential nutrients like iron, zinc, and vitamin B12, adding to general health and wellness.

Crafting biltong is both a science and an art. The method begins with selecting high-quality cuts of meat, which are then sliced into strips of varying thickness. The meat is marinated in vinegar, sometimes with Worcestershire sauce for added depth, and then coated with a spice mixture. After marination, the strips are hung in a well-ventilated area to dry naturally. The drying period, which typically lasts between 3 to 10 days, depends upon the desired texture—whether soft and moist or dry and chewy. Many biltong enthusiasts try out spices and drying times to create their signature flavors.

What is a Crypto Exchange? A cryptocurrency exchange is a digital platform that allows users to buy, sell, and trade cryptocurrencies. These exchanges serve as intermediaries between buyers and sellers, facilitating transactions in a safe and secure environment. They provide access to a range of c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and many others.

Crypto exchanges typically offer two types of services: centralized and decentralized. Centralized exchanges (CEX) are the most common and popular platforms. They are controlled by a central entity, and users must trust this entity to bitcoin trading their funds and execute transactions. Some of the largest centralized exchanges include Binance, Coinbase, and Kraken. On the other hand, decentralized exchanges (DEX) operate without a central authority, and users can trade directly with each other. Popular DEXs include Uniswap and PancakeSwap.

The choice of exchange depends on various factors such as ease of use, fees, available coins, security features, and the geographical location of the user. While centralized exchanges often offer a more user-friendly experience and greater liquidity, decentralized exchanges provide more control and privacy over transactions.

How to Buy Bitcoin Buying Bitcoin can seem like a complicated process, but it is quite straightforward once you break it down into steps. To begin, you'll need to select a crypto exchange that suits your needs. Once you've chosen an exchange, follow these general steps:

Create an Account: The first step is to register for an account with the exchange of your choice. You'll need to provide personal information and complete identity verification (a process known as KYC – Know Your Customer) to comply with anti-money laundering (AML) regulations.

Deposit Funds: After account verification, you'll need to deposit funds into your account. Most exchanges accept deposits in fiat currencies like USD, EUR, GBP, or others via bank transfer, credit card, or even PayPal. Some exchanges may also allow you to deposit other cryptocurrencies, which can then be used to buy Bitcoin.

Buy Bitcoin: Once your account is funded, you can place an order to buy Bitcoin. There are typically two types of orders you can place: a market order or a limit order. A market order buys Bitcoin at the current market price, while a limit order lets you specify a price at which you're willing to buy. Limit orders are useful if you want to buy Bitcoin at a lower price than the current market rate, but they may not execute immediately.

Store Your Bitcoin: After purchasing Bitcoin, you'll want to store it in a secure wallet. Crypto exchanges offer built-in wallets, but for enhanced security, it's recommended to transfer your Bitcoin to a private wallet. There are two main types of wallets: hot wallets (online wallets) and cold wallets (offline storage). Cold wallets, like hardware wallets, provide a higher level of security as they are not connected to the internet, making them less vulnerable to hacking.

Trading Bitcoin Once you've purchased Bitcoin, you may want to trade it to take advantage of price fluctuations. Bitcoin trading involves buying and selling Bitcoin to profit from the difference in price over time. Trading Bitcoin can be done in several ways, each with its own strategies and techniques.

Spot Trading: This is the most straightforward form of trading, where you buy Bitcoin at one price and sell it at another. Spot trading involves purchasing Bitcoin and selling it at current market prices, without the use of leverage or margin. It's ideal for beginners as it's simple and easy to understand.

Margin Trading: Margin trading allows traders to borrow funds to increase their position size and amplify potential profits. While this can lead to higher returns, it also increases the risk of losses, especially if the market moves against the position. Margin trading is suitable for more experienced traders who understand the risks involved.

Futures Trading: Bitcoin futures trading allows traders to speculate on the price of Bitcoin at a future date. These contracts are agreements to buy or sell Bitcoin at a predetermined price at a specified time. Futures trading is often used by professional traders and investors to hedge against price volatility or to profit from both rising and falling markets.

Swing Trading: Swing trading involves holding Bitcoin for a few days to weeks, depending on market conditions. Traders aim to profit from short- to medium-term price movements by analyzing market trends, news, and technical indicators. Swing trading requires a good understanding of market analysis, but it offers the potential for significant profits during volatile periods.

Day Trading: Day trading is an active strategy where traders buy and sell Bitcoin within the same trading day to capitalize on small price movements. Day traders typically rely on technical analysis and short-term indicators to make quick decisions. It requires a lot of time, attention, and expertise, and is not recommended for beginners.

Risks and Challenges in Bitcoin Trading While the potential for profit in Bitcoin trading is high, it's important to understand the risks involved. The cryptocurrency market is known for its volatility, and Bitcoin is no exception. Prices can fluctuate dramatically in short periods, leading to potential losses if not managed properly.

Additionally, there are risks related to security. Hacking incidents, exchange failures, and scams are unfortunate realities of the crypto world. As a result, it is essential to use secure exchanges, employ strong password practices, and store your Bitcoin in a private wallet if possible.

Regulatory uncertainties also pose challenges. Different countries have different rules regarding cryptocurrency trading, and the legal landscape is still evolving. It's important to stay informed about your local regulations to avoid potential legal issues.
